-- The Digital Enterprise number is 36.
-- The ASN.1 prefix to, and including the Digital Enterprise is:
-- 1.3.6.1.4.1.36
--
-- Description:
-- This MIB extension allows for the management of Compaq Corp., Digital
-- Equipment Corp., and other 3rd party cluster products. It allows for
-- ease of cluster and node member identification.

-- textual conventions for types
-- For ease of use and to allow for optional registration by external
-- organizations, there is a specific formula to use to compute the
-- value for a particular cluster type. The cluster type formula =
-- (enterprise number * 100) + n where n = 0..99. N is a number that
-- each company (enterprise number) manages.
-- Cluster Type value of 1 - 2 will remain valid, numbers 3 - 7 are
-- grandfathered in from svrclu version 1.0.
ClusterType ::= INTEGER {
unknown(1) ,
other(2) ,
digitalNT(3) ,
microsoftNT(4) ,
digitalUnixASE(5) ,
digitalUnixTCR(6) ,
openVMS(7),
compaqTruClusterAvailableServer(3601),
compaqTruClusterProductionServer(3602),
compaqTruClusterServer(3603),
compaqOpenVms(3604),
cpqclusterMSCS(23200),
compaqMSCS(23201)
}
ClusterStatus ::= INTEGER {
unknown(1) , -- Cluster status is unknown
other(2) , -- Not one of the following:
notInstalled(3) , -- The cluster software isn't installed
notRunning(4) , -- The managed node's cluster software
-- has not started
initializing(5) , -- The managed node's cluster software
-- is initializing
running(6) , -- The cluster is functioning normally
suspended(7) , -- Cluster activity is temporarily suspended.
-- This could be due to member transition,
-- loss of quorum, etc.
failed(8) -- An unrecoverable error occurred.
}
MemberStatus ::= INTEGER {
unknown(1) , -- Members status is unknown
other(2) , -- Not one of the following:
new(3) , -- The node is known to the cluster, but is
-- not yet a member.
normal(4) , -- The node is an operational cluster member
removed(5) -- The member was removed from the cluster.
-- This is a transitional state that may be
-- returned rarely or not at all. An
-- implementation may simply remove this
-- members's corresponding row in
-- svrCluMemberTable.
}

svrCluMemberAddressTable OBJECT-TYPE
SYNTAX SEQUENCE OF SvrCluMemberAddressEntry
ACCESS not-accessible
STATUS mandatory
DESCRIPTION
"This table represents the managed nodes's knowledge of the
IP addressed configured on the other cluster members.
This provides a hint for reaching the other members, and
a low-level mechanism for identifying members of the same
cluster.
Note that the managed node's addressing information is already
available in ipAddrTable, so is not required to be present in
this table"
::={svrCluClusterInfo 12 }
